Roblox Unblocked GitHub refers to a popular method used by students and employees to access Roblox on restricted networks by leveraging GitHub Pages to host web-based proxies or game clones. These repositories typically provide a workaround for firewalls that block the official Roblox website or application. Understanding Roblox Unblocked GitHub

The primary appeal of "unblocked" versions on GitHub is that GitHub itself is often categorized as an educational or development tool by network filters, making it less likely to be blocked than gaming sites. Developers create repositories that essentially "tunnel" the game through a browser-based interface, often using technologies like WebAssembly or Javascript proxies. Key Features of These Repositories

Web-Based Access: Most GitHub "unblocked" projects aim to run the game directly in a browser (like Chrome or Safari) without requiring a local installation or administrator privileges.

Proxy Integration: Many links found on GitHub are actually mirrors for web proxies (like Ultraviolet or Rammerhead). These proxies mask the traffic, making it appear as though the user is simply browsing GitHub rather than playing a game.

Frequent Updates: Because network administrators constantly update their blocklists, the GitHub community frequently "forks" (copies) repositories to create new, unblocked URLs. Potential Risks and Considerations

While these links are convenient, they come with significant caveats:

Security Risks: Not all repositories are safe. Some "unblocked" sites may contain malicious scripts, phishing attempts to steal your Roblox login credentials, or intrusive advertisements.

Performance Issues: Playing Roblox through a web proxy often results in high latency (lag) and lower frame rates compared to the native application.

Account Safety: Logging into your primary Roblox account on a third-party unblocked site is risky. It is generally recommended to use an "alt" (alternative) account to prevent your main account from being compromised.

Terms of Service: Using unofficial methods to access Roblox may technically violate their Terms of Service, though the primary risk is usually a local network disciplinary action (like school or work consequences) rather than an account ban. How to Find Reliable Sources

To find the most current versions, users often search for terms like "Roblox Web" or "Proxy" within the GitHub search bar and sort by "Most Stars" or "Recently Updated." This ensures the repository is being maintained and is less likely to be a dead link.

The "Uncopylocked" Preservation Movement One of the most compelling stories on regarding Roblox is the Old-Open-Source-Levels repository

. This project acts as a digital museum for "uncopylocked" games—experiences where the original creators allowed anyone to view and copy their code. The Mission

: It preserves games that are at risk of disappearing, such as those by developers who have left the platform or games that were once open but later locked. Community Impact : Developers like GamerOkami

have famously "retired" by uncopylocking their entire portfolios—some with millions of visits—to allow new creators to learn from a decade of code. Developer Forum | Roblox The "Unblocked" Tug-of-War
